Common Web Design Mistakes and How to Avoid Them
Many developing websites suffer from simple design errors that can seriously damage the user interaction. Regularly, these shortcomings stem from simple oversights. Here's a glance at some typical pitfalls and how to bypass them. Firstly, inadequate navigation frustrate visitors, making it hard for them to discover what they need. Guarantee your site has a straightforward and intuitive menu. Secondly, ignoring mobile responsiveness is a significant blunder; your website needs to look good on every device. Focus on a responsive design template. Thirdly, excessive clutter and a poor color scheme can be visually overwhelming . Simplify your design and select a pleasing color plan . Finally, failing to to optimize graphics can hinder page performance times, leading to user frustration . Compress your images while sacrificing visual appeal.
- Navigation: Implement a clear menu.
- Responsiveness: Integrate a responsive design.
- Visual Design: Minimize clutter and pick a pleasing color scheme.
- Performance: Compress image sizes.

Web Design: Choosing the Right Tools & Technologies
Selecting the appropriate software and frameworks for your web design can seem a challenging task . Think about whether you need a full-fledged code editor like Visual Studio Code, Sublime Text, or Atom – or if a simpler web-based tool such as Webflow is sufficient. Furthermore , grasp the importance of core web technologies – along with potentially useful technologies like Node.js, Python (with Django or Flask), or PHP . The right choice depends on your skill level and needs .
